Think about the single target rotation of a medicine OP. If you are lucky you can open with hidden strike, but with the psychic stealth detection mobs have, that is maybe 50/50 at best, unless its all alone. Backstab doesn't work now because the operative has aggro. You're left with shiv, explosive probe, and corrosive dart with rifle shot as filler in all too many places, because of the cooldowns on those. You can hit debilitate and get a backstab there, and if your timing is incrediblely good, flashbang will get you another. Most of the time I try not to heal early so that my companion gets some aggro from any adds so I can backstab them. Thankfully I can toss in orbital strike to speed things along.
What about standard/weak adds and AOE? Well believe it or not, I rarely bother with orbital strike for those. Firstly, it takes far too long to activate and for the damage to come down on a weak pack of mobs. Thermal grenade and carbine burst are where its at. With Thermal grenade I can knock a standard down and backstab them while they are laying...on their back. And as medicine I can get 3 TA so 3 carbine bursts on a nice group of standards pretty much destroys them, with the grenade AOE adding a bit more damage on top.
